Please, PLEASE don’t ever do this to people. It’s no good for you, them or anyone. It’s not wrong because it’s “childish” it is wrong for the following and more:

- When someone accepts a ‘don’t talk to me right now’, they’re actually respecting your boundaries, yes, some of the people who indeed just say okay might ‘not actually care’ about you, but others are actually listening to you saying no, which is THE DECENT THING TO DO. As a test then, this fails entirely, because you can’t discern between the two groups

- Saying one thing expecting people to do the other is manipulative, is the basis of abusive behaviour and can even be ableist as it assumes the other person can pick up on very specific social cues when they might not… and even more, those social cues are TERRIBLY WRONG as explained in my next point

- You are reinforcing the idea that when people (especially girls) say no and set boundaries, they actually mean yes and are extending an invitation. Society as a whole teaches girls that they should play ‘hard to get’, they teach girls to say no when they mean yes, and they teach boys that girls say no when they mean yes - and although that’s not the only reason why girls’ boundaries are not respected, it is a big part of why when a girl says no, men assume they just have to insist. Obviously, this is not the whole extent of rape culture, this is not the cause of it, this is not going to directly cause anyone to become a rapist - but it’s a behaviour that it’s in line with the line of thought that girls’ boundaries should not be respected.

Please, if you care about someone, if you care about yourself, do not ever engage in this behaviour. It’s so so so harmful.
